The King James Version (KJV) of the Bible reads as follows, "Verily, verily, I say unto you, He that believeth on me, the works that I do shall he do also; and greater works than these shall he do..." We will do greater works than Jesus? Did Jesus really say that? Didn't Jesus do miracles? So, what's up with us anyway?
We've been told too many times over too many years, by too many people that our fate is linked to our sins, that we're limited to mediocrity: just trying to overcome our sins! We spend too much time and money getting a FACE LIFT when what we need is a FAITH LIFT! We can't say we BELIEVE A during the night and then lay waken in fear and trembling that B is happening.
We're human and if there is anything humans can't do is walk on WATER (as Jesus did).
Well, how about walking on FIRE? Isn't that pretty miraculous? Amanda Dennison (23 years old)holds the record for walking 220 feet over coals measured at 1600-1800 degrees fahrenheit. It took her a little over 30 seconds to complete the walk. So, you don't think fire-walking is a miracle?
How about Angela Cavallo (weighing in at 130lbs wet) who saved her trapped son by lifting a 1964 Chevrolet for nearly five minutes while rescuers arrived and extracted her unconscious son. Hey, it's on video. Or what about the construction worker who lifted a 3,000+ pound helicopter from a drainage ditch to rescue a pilot?
It’s almost too unbelievable, right?
And I've not begun to mention those radicals in the hills of Eastern America where the Free Pentecostal Holiness Church resides. They regularly get bit by poisonous copperheads and rattlesnakes and show no effects. But then they top that off with a drink of toxic strychnine and go out for lunch after church.
Anyone thirsty? :-)
We seldom get the chance to life helicopters, cars, or even the desire to be a firewalker, but how about some safe things like praying for the sick, or a couple of those "heal thyself physician" episodes? Like being pregnant, you are or you aren't. We can't BELIEVE 95-99%: it's an all or nothing gambit. It's a trial and error experience. And, it's a BELIEF in who we really are and not what we've been TAUGHT or what we SEE with our physical eyes.
How serious are you for those "greater things"? Shall we leave the miracles to the secular world outside the church walls or shall we get more serious in BEING who we ARE, and not who we've been taught that we are?
